Project Engineer
We're looking for Project Engineers to join our Anglian Water team based in Norwich
Location: Norwich, Norfolk
Hours: 45 hours per week - some flexibility on hours available if desired, just let us know when you speak to us.
We are unable to offer certificates of sponsorship to any candidates in this role.
As a Project Engineer, you'll play a vital role in ensuring our projects are delivered successfully from start to finish on our Anglian Water IOS framework. You'll work closely with the Construction Manager and operational teams to meet all required standards, regulations and timeframes, whilst supporting the delivery of Anglian Water project needs. This is an opportunity to use your technical expertise and problem-solving skills to make a real impact.
What will you be responsible for?
As a Project Engineer, you'll be working within the Anglian Water IOS team, supporting them in delivering high-quality water and wastewater projects.
Your day to day will include:
- Supporting operational and project delivery managers in meeting Anglian Water project needs
- Developing solutions in line with technical and safety standards, ensuring all design, programme and CDM requirements are completed
- Completing all necessary CDM documents and compiling contract documentation
- Coordinating with suppliers, subcontractors and in-house functions to ensure smooth project delivery
- Ensuring compliance with all Health & Safety, Environmental and Quality requirements on site
What are we looking for?
This role of Project Engineer is great for you if you hold:
- Temporary Works Coordinator qualification and an engineering degree or equivalent
- Experience in capital delivery within the water sector with a key focus on directly employed staff delivering projects
- Management of the Construction Design Management regulations (CDM)
- Excellent knowledge and experience in customer management as well as external stakeholders
- Commercial awareness working with multiple stakeholders
- Confined spaces training, or willingness to achieve
- Full driving licence
